自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(20)
  • 收藏
  • 关注

转载 typedef的用法

不管实在C还是C++代码中,typedef这个词都不少见,当然出现频率较高的还是在C代码中。typedef与#define有些相似,但更多的是不同,特别是在一些复杂的用法上,就完全不同了,看了网上一些C/C++的学习者的博客,其中有一篇关于typedef的总结还是很不错,由于总结的很好,我就不加修改的引用过来了,以下是引用的内容(红色部分是我自己写的内容)。 用途一: 定义一种类型的别

2016-10-14 11:05:45 166

原创 java反射+枚举+泛型

1.调用反射的三种方法 2.class.forName 动态编译 静态加载类,是编译时刻加载;动态加载类,是运行时刻加载new创建对象:是静态加载类,在编译时刻就需要加载所有的【可能使用到的类】。有一个类有问题(如不存在),都不能通过编译,会报错。Class.forName()通过动态加载类,可以用到一个类时,才进行加载。【功能性的类尽量使用动态加载,并对新添的类实现功能性接口(标准)

2016-10-10 11:46:33 931

原创 jdbc

1.用于将java和数据库联系在一起,用JAVA操作数据库 2.步骤如下:                                  注意要对应数据库名字,用户名和密码,还有网络地址

2016-09-22 20:03:28 219

原创 jaVa的多线程

基本概念 1.进程:是程序或任务的执行的过程,具有动态性,它持有资源(共享内存,共享文件)和线程(即进程是资源和线程的载体) 2.线程:是系统中最小的执行单元,同一进程中有多个线程,线程共享线程的资源 3.线程交互:即线程通信 4.线程之间存在同步和互斥                常用方法

2016-09-21 11:10:41 304 1

原创 java网络通信

1 .

2016-09-19 21:40:25 272 1

原创 java对象的序列化与反序列化

IO——对象的序列化和反序列化 一、概念 1、对象序列化,就是将Object转换成byte序列,反之叫对象的反序列化 2、序列化流(ObjectOutputStream),字节的过滤流 —— writeObject()方法 反序列化流(ObjectInputStream)—— readObject()方法 3、序列化接口(Serializable) 对象必须实现序列化接口,才能进行序列

2016-09-19 11:59:52 304

原创 java字符流printwrite pw= new printwrite(文件路径/outputStream); pw.print(line);

字符流: 1)编码问题 2)认识文本和文本文件       java的文本(char)是16位无符号整数,是字符的unicode编码(双字节编码)      文件是byte byte。。。。的数据序列      文件文件是文本(char)序列按照某种编码方案(utf-8,utf-16be,gbk)序列化为byte的存储结果 3)字符流常用的类--》一般处理文本文件      read

2016-09-19 09:22:11 1953

原创 Java文件处理+文件流

1.新建文件及文件目录 2.判断文件是否存在?+抛出异常 File e=new File("e:\\ii"); if(e.exists())     System.out.println("true"); else e.mkdir();//创建目录

2016-09-18 11:47:06 672

原创 java进制+文件

1.进制转换 10进制到其他进制 integer.tobinary等函数 其他进制到10进制integer.p...函数 2.GBK;UTF-8;UTF-16E中BYTE与字符串之间的转换 3.创建新的文件要记住抛出异常

2016-09-18 11:21:25 131

原创 java进制转换

1.进制转换 2.字节类型转换

2016-09-12 09:23:03 154

原创 java中的集合框架

1.是一种工具类,就像是容器,存储任意数量的具有共同属性的对象 2.集合类的分类 List Queue存储的元素排列有序并且可重复数据set中的元素无序并且可重复key value可以是任意类型的对象 3.collection接口    ArrayList&list增删改查泛型

2016-09-10 15:43:38 187

原创 math类的使用

2016-09-10 15:37:29 181

原创 string常用方法

1.常用方法 ==: 判断两个字符串在内存中首地址是否相同,即判断是否是同一个字符串对象equals(): 比较存储在两个字符串对象中的内容是否一致 2、stringbuilder() 程序运行时会额外创建一个对象,保存 "helloworld"。当频繁操作字符串时,就会额外产生很多临时变量。使用 StringBuilder 或 StringBuffer 就可以避免这

2016-09-10 15:11:25 158

原创 java多态

1、引用多态 父类的引用可以指向本类的对象 父类的引用可以指向子类的对象 2、方法多态 创建本类对象时,调用的方法为本类方法 创建子类对象时,调用的方法为子类重写的方法或者继承的方法 注意:如果是子类独有的方法,在父类中是没有的,则不能使用父类引用指向子类对象来执行在子类中的方法。 3.类型转换(难点)    Animal obj4=new cat();//向上类型转换

2016-09-09 15:42:21 173

原创 Java特性继承

1、引用多态 父类的引用可以指向本类的对象 父类的引用可以指向子类的对象 2、方法多态 创建本类对象时,调用的方法为本类方法 创建子类对象时,调用的方法为子类重写的方法或者继承的方法 注意:如果是子类独有的方法,在父类中是没有的,则不能使用父类引用指向子类对象来执行在子类中的方法。 3.类型转换(难点)    Animal obj4=new cat();//向上类型转换

2016-09-09 11:12:12 301

原创 java特性-封装

1.封装 private-getter/setter-控制信息

2016-09-08 22:00:48 212

原创 java类的复习

1.类中包含:属性、方法 2.步骤: 创建类:定义方法和属性 实例化 3.局部变量和成员变量 成员变量在类中使用,能被所有方法使用, 局部变量只是在方法内使用,不会自动赋初始值,在一个方法内不能同名; 两个变量重名,局部变量优先级更高;

2016-09-07 16:32:12 168

原创 java中的方法

语法格式: 1、 访问修饰符:方法允许被访问的权限范围, 可以是 public、protected、private 甚至可以省略 ,其中 public 表示该方法可以被其他任何代码调用,其他几种修饰符的使用在后面章节中会详细讲解滴 2、 返回值类型:方法返回值的类型,如果方法不返回任何值,则返回值类型指定为 void ;如果方法具有返回值,则需要指定返回值的类型,并且在方法体中使用

2016-09-07 15:34:15 139

原创 java复习

1.逻辑运算符

2016-09-06 22:40:46 175

原创 JAVA的安装

一年前把JAVA开了个头,但一直没认真学习 今天重新装了ECLIPSE IDE 还有J2EE 认真学学 java 在求职也是必须的敲门砖啊

2016-09-06 21:14:44 201

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除